Lead Data Engineer

Remote

Applications have closed

TrustEngine

The Borrower Intelligence Platform from TrustEngine helps lenders increase loan applications, build customer loyalty, and boost borrower retention.

View company page

Company Overview
TrustEngine is the world's first Automated Borrower Intelligence System, and we believe in a simple idea: that banks and mortgage lenders can win by over-serving their customers rather than over-selling them. Our mission is we will empower Lenders to become lifelong champions for Borrowers and we fulfill this mission through our SaaS platform. We provide the lending community tools to inform them when anyone in their database is ready for a better loan.
 
We are considered the leaders in our space, and we’re growing incredibly fast. If you’re interested come see for yourself!

Job Summary:

Bring your deep expertise in building out data pipelines and implementing data lake architecture. As a seasoned data engineer, you will elevate your team, foster collaboration, and drive continuous improvement to deliver industry-transforming products with technical excellence. You will take the lead in designing and implementing a scalable data platform as the foundation of our tech stack. Collaborating with cross-functional teams, you will serve as a subject matter expert to drive data-driven decision-making and create innovative solutions for our customers. 

Join us and shape the future of mortgage tech!

Responsibilities

  • Design and develop robust data pipelines and ETL processes for ingesting, transforming, and integrating data from various sources into the data lake.
  • Optimize data infrastructure for performance, reliability, and scalability, considering factors such as data volume, velocity, and variety.
  • Ensure data quality, integrity, and security across the data lake, implementing data governance practices and monitoring mechanisms.
  • Collaborate with cross-functional teams, including data scientists, analysts, and software engineers, to understand data requirements and develop solutions that meet business needs.
  • Champion engineering best practices and drive improvements in data engineering methodologies, processes, and technologies.
  • Stay updated with emerging trends and advancements in data engineering, sharing knowledge and insights with the team and the broader organization.
  • Effectively communicate technical concepts, solutions, and recommendations to both technical and non-technical stakeholders.

Required Qualifications

  • 8+ years of professional experience in data engineering, building scalable data pipelines and ETL processes.
  • Strong proficiency in programming languages commonly used in data engineering, such as Java, Scala, or Python.
  • In-depth knowledge of distributed systems, data processing frameworks (such as Hadoop, Spark, or Flink), data lake, and cloud computing platforms (e.g., AWS, Google Cloud, Azure).
  • Proficient in SQL and relational database technologies (e.g., MySQL, PostgreSQL)
  • Strong knowledge of data modeling, and data warehousing concepts.
  • Familiarity with data governance, security, access controls, and compliance principles and solutions.
  • Demonstrated ability to optimize data pipelines for performance, scalability, and reliability.
  • Excellent problem-solving and analytical skills, with a passion for tackling complex data engineering challenges.
  • Excellent influencing and communication skills, with the ability to inspire and motivate others toward a shared vision.

Preferred Qualifications

  • Experience with real-time data processing and streaming frameworks (e.g., Kafka, AWS Kinesis).
  • Knowledge of modern data lakehouse technologies such as Apache Hudi, Delta Lake, or Apache Iceberg
  • Experience with  NoSQL databases (e.g., Redis, Cassandra)
  • Experience with data visualization tools (e.g., Tableau, Metabase) and data exploration techniques.
  • Previous experience leading a team of data engineers or providing technical leadership in data engineering projects.
  • Contributions to open-source data engineering projects or active participation in the data engineering community.

Education & Experience

  • Bachelor's degree in Computer Science or a related technical field. Advanced degrees are preferred but not required. Equivalent practical experience will also be considered.
Additional Job Requirements:
●      Must successfully pass a background check
●      Provide references
●      Applicants may be subject to Employment, Education, and Certification Verification.
 
For salary requirements, please reach out to hr@trustengine.com
 
Our benefits include but are not limited to the following: 100% company paid medical; company matching 401(k), paid maternity and paternity leave, unlimited FTO package, ongoing professional development and certification opportunities, competitive salary, special employee discounts and health and wellness perks.
 
 TrustEngine provides equal employment opportunities to all employees and applicants for employment and prohibits discrimination and harassment of any type without regard to race, color, religion, age, sex, national origin, disability status, genetics, protected veteran status, sexual orientation, gender identity or expression, or any other characteristic protected by federal, state or local laws.
 
This policy applies to all employment practices within our organization, including hiring, recruiting, promotion, termination, layoff, recall, leave of absence, compensation, benefits, training, and apprenticeship. TrustEngine makes hiring decisions based solely on qualifications, merit, and business needs at the time.
 

* Salary range is an estimate based on our AI, ML, Data Science Salary Index 💰

Tags: Architecture AWS Azure Cassandra Computer Science Data governance Data pipelines Data quality Data visualization Data Warehousing Distributed Systems Engineering ETL Flink GCP Google Cloud Hadoop Java Kafka Kinesis Metabase MySQL NoSQL Open Source Pipelines PostgreSQL Python RDBMS Scala Security Spark SQL Streaming Tableau

Perks/benefits: Career development Competitive pay Health care Medical leave Parental leave Startup environment

Region: Remote/Anywhere
Job stats:  8  3  0

More jobs like this

Explore more AI, ML, Data Science career opportunities

Find even more open roles in Artificial Intelligence (AI), Machine Learning (ML), Natural Language Processing (NLP), Computer Vision (CV), Data Engineering, Data Analytics, Big Data, and Data Science in general - ordered by popularity of job title or skills, toolset and products used - below.